Katyeyes Salary

As of August 2026, the average hourly salary for employees at Katyeyes in the United States is $38. This translates to an approximate annual wage of $78,412. Salaries at Katyeyes typically range from $33 to $43 hourly,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Houston?

Understanding the cost of living near Houston is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Katyeyes.
Houston's Cost of Living Index is approximately 98.5 (1.5% less expensive than US average; 5.9% more than TX average). Major city, energy/medical hub, housing generally affordable for size, but varies. METRO bus/rail. When planning your budget based on a salary from Katyeyes, consider these typical monthly expenses:
